WebEarly alternator-equipped Beetles use a Bosch alternator with an external regulator (BOS-0-190-600-017) screwed to the left wall under the rear seat. The regulator controls the voltage/current fed to the rotor's electromagnet coil windings through terminals D- and DF to provide an output voltage at the D+ or B+ terminals of about 14.5V. When ... WebTo troubleshoot this issue, start by checking the battery voltage with a multimeter. A healthy battery should read around 12.6 volts when the engine is off. If the voltage is significantly lower, it may indicate a problem with the alternator. Solution: If the alternator is not charging the battery properly, it may need to be replaced. Web15 de jun. de 2024 · Check the bearings of the alternator. Use a rubber hose to do this. It works like a stethoscope. Place one end of the hose on the metal alternator case and the other to your ear. If there is loud grinding or squeaking as you listen there could be a bearing failure that begins in the alternator and you’ll need to replace it. Testing with a ...
